(a,b) *(c,d) =(ac,b+ad) Find out it is commucative or not

(a,b)*(c,d) = (ac, b+ad) (c,d)*(a,b) = (ca, d+cb) As, (a,b)*(c,d) =/= (c,d)*(a,b) So, it is not commutative...
